    Brewers' Chris Carter: Homers for third time versus Pirates this season

    Carter went 4-for-5 with a home run, three RBI and two runs in a 7-4 victory over the Pirates on Saturday.

    He went deep in the sixth to put Milwaukee on the board and give the Brewers the lead. Then, his RBI single in the ninth provided an insurance run. Carter is hitting .300 with three homers and nine RBI versus the Pirates this season. He leads the league in strikeouts but also has 31 home runs.

    Reds' Joey Votto: On base four times in return to action

    Votto (neck) went 1-for-2 with a double, RBI, three walks and two runs in Saturday's 9-1 victory over the Cardinals.

    It was a typical Votto stat line, with the former All-Star even driving in one run with a bases-loaded walk in the eighth. The 32-year-old had actually not drawn a free pass since his last three-walk outing, which came Aug. 26 against the D-backs. Votto now has hits in four straight and has his season line up to .310/.433/.526 following Saturday's effort.

  • Braves' Freddie Freeman: Extends hitting streak, reaches four times Friday

    Freeman went 2-for-3 with a pair of doubles, one of which produced a ninth-inning go-ahead RBI, two walks and two runs in Friday's 8-4 victory over the Phillies.

    The standout first baseman continued his recent tear, hitting safely for the ninth straight contest and getting on base four times overall. Freeman supplied an extremely timely piece of hitting in the ninth, blasting a two-bagger to left that brought in Ender Inciarte and snapped a 4-4 tie. He scored later in the frame on a Nick Markakis double, and is now 3-for-6 with Friday's doubles, a homer, four RBI, four runs and four walks over the first two games of September.

    Phillies' Ryan Howard: Two hits Friday

    Howard started at first base Friday and went 2-for-4 with a double and an RBI in an 8-4 loss to the Braves.

    Manager Pete Mackanin said earlier this week that Howard's role would be reduced, which led to Howard voicing his displeasure in the media. On Friday, Mackanin clarified his position, telling Jim Salisbury of CSN Philadelphia that Howard would "get more playing time than he thinks." Howard has made a case for playing time with a .295/.330/.632 slash line and nine home runs since the beginning of July.

    White Sox's Jose Abreu: Records three hits for second straight night

    Abreu went 3-for-6 with three RBI in a 11-4 victory over the Twins on Friday.

    This was the second straight night the first baseman had three hits. He has a modest five-game hitting streak, going 11-for-23 (.478) with three extra-base hits, including two homers during that stretch. Abreu is hitting .293 with 20 homers, 79 RBI and 53 runs in 518 at-bats.
